Transaction d789bdcb0497c8692d6e3ff67096d6c2f0778e995cfe34f41e97c3e681512b0b
1 Input
1 Output
-
d789bdcb0497c8692d6e3ff67096d6c2f0778e995cfe34f41e97c3e681512b0b:0
- value
- 8527740
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ba24a8b77188f348cbe7b851169a4379bab1a23d OP_EQUAL
- address
- 3JfFXLefWHZVBDNZVdAQAiakajZnJZFAFZ